Find everything you need to get certified on Fabric—skills challenges, live sessions, exam prep, role guidance, and a 50 percent discount on exams.
Get startedEarn a 50% discount on the DP-600 certification exam by completing the Fabric 30 Days to Learn It challenge.
Hi everyone! I've created a report using direct query connection to Azure SQL database. From my understanding, direct query means that data gets updated in real time but I noticed that there is a Scheduled Refresh section in my published dataset where I can select the time the dataset gets refreshed. My question is, is it necessary to set up Scheduled refresh with direct query? Or is scheduled refresh only necessary when you're using Import/Mixed connection? Thank you in advance!
Solved! Go to Solution.
Hi @NZ0090 ,
Power BI doesn't import data over connections that operate in DirectQuery mode. The dataset returns results from the underlying data source whenever a report or dashboard queries the dataset. Power BI transforms and forwards the queries to the data source.
Because Power BI doesn't import the data, you don't need to run a data refresh. However, Power BI still performs tile refreshes and possibly report refreshes . In addition, if the gateway is not configured, the report of the DQ connection mode cannot obtain the latest data.
Whether you need to configure scheduled refresh for reports in Direct Query mode depends on your needs.
Please refer to the following document for more information.
Data refresh in Power BI - Power BI | Microsoft Learn
Best Regards,
Neeko Tang
If this post helps, then please consider Accept it as the solution to help the other members find it more quickly.
hello, Direct Query means that opening or refreshing a report or dashboard will always show the latest data in the source!
https://docs.microsoft.com/en-us/power-bi/desktop-directquery-about
Hi! Yes I do know that, but my question is whether it's necessary to set scheduled refresh if I'm using direct query.
Hi @NZ0090 ,
Power BI doesn't import data over connections that operate in DirectQuery mode. The dataset returns results from the underlying data source whenever a report or dashboard queries the dataset. Power BI transforms and forwards the queries to the data source.
Because Power BI doesn't import the data, you don't need to run a data refresh. However, Power BI still performs tile refreshes and possibly report refreshes . In addition, if the gateway is not configured, the report of the DQ connection mode cannot obtain the latest data.
Whether you need to configure scheduled refresh for reports in Direct Query mode depends on your needs.
Please refer to the following document for more information.
Data refresh in Power BI - Power BI | Microsoft Learn
Best Regards,
Neeko Tang
If this post helps, then please consider Accept it as the solution to help the other members find it more quickly.